General Information about Cocoa Brown
The hexadecimal color code #302321, commonly known as Cocoa Brown, is a dark shade of brown. It is composed of 18.82% red, 13.73% green, and 12.94% blue. In the RGB color model, this translates to 48 red, 35 green, and 33 blue. In the CMYK color model, it is composed of 0% cyan, 27.08% magenta, 31.25% yellow, and 81.18% black. The hue angle is 11.2 degrees, its saturation is 16.67%, and the lightness value is 15.9%. This color evokes a sense of warmth, earthiness, and comfort. It is often associated with nature, stability, and reliability, making it a versatile choice for various design applications. Cocoa Brown is a muted and understated color, lending itself well to backgrounds, accents, and branding elements.
The hex color #302321, also known as Cocoa Brown, presents some accessibility challenges, particularly concerning color contrast. When used as text against a white background, the contrast ratio may not meet WCAG (Web Content Accessibility Guidelines) standards for Level AA or AAA compliance. This means that users with moderate visual impairments might find it difficult to read. To improve accessibility, consider using #302321 for larger text sizes or pairing it with a much lighter background color to increase the contrast ratio. Alternatively, it may be suitable for decorative elements where readability is not crucial. Always test color combinations with accessibility tools to ensure sufficient contrast for users with visual impairments. If the color is used in charts or graphs, ensure there are alternative cues like labels or patterns to convey information to individuals who cannot distinguish between colors.

Applications
Website Backgrounds
Cocoa Brown (#302321) can be effectively used in website backgrounds to create a warm and inviting atmosphere. It works well for websites related to coffee shops, bakeries, or any brand aiming for a rustic or natural feel. The color provides a subtle, earthy tone that doesn't distract from the content while adding depth to the overall design. Its subdued nature also pairs well with brighter accent colors, allowing for a balanced and visually appealing user interface. Using it for section dividers or subtle patterns can add to the aesthetic without overwhelming the user.
Interior Design
In interior design, Cocoa Brown (#302321) serves as a grounding neutral, ideal for walls in living rooms or bedrooms seeking a cozy ambiance. It pairs beautifully with creams, beiges, and muted greens, creating a natural and harmonious palette. Using this color for accent walls can add depth and warmth to a room. Furthermore, it works effectively for furniture upholstery, particularly for sofas and armchairs, providing a comfortable and inviting feel. Accessorizing with textures like wool and linen can enhance the overall sense of warmth.
Branding and Packaging
Cocoa Brown (#302321) is a sophisticated choice for branding elements like logos and packaging, especially for brands focused on natural, organic, or artisanal products. It conveys a sense of warmth, reliability, and authenticity. Using this color for product packaging can give it a premium and earthy feel, making it stand out on shelves. Furthermore, it can be incorporated into business cards and marketing materials to create a consistent and recognizable brand identity, evoking feelings of comfort and trust among customers.
